Spanish Translation: Pelirrojos

The Spanish term for red heads is “pelirrojos.” This word is derived from the combination of two Spanish words: “pelo” meaning hair, and “rojo” meaning red. When combined, they create a term specifically used to describe individuals with red hair.

Usage and Context

The term “pelirrojos” is widely used in Spanish-speaking countries to refer to people with red hair. It is a neutral term and is not considered offensive or derogatory. In fact, it is often used affectionately or playfully, highlighting the uniqueness and beauty of red-headed individuals.

Alternative Terms

While “pelirrojos” is the most common term used to describe red heads in Spanish, there are a few alternative terms that are occasionally used in different regions or contexts. These terms include: 1. “Cabezas de Fuego” – This phrase translates to “heads of fire” and is a creative way to describe red heads. It emphasizes the fiery nature of their hair color. 2. “Rojizos” – This term is derived from the Spanish word “rojo” meaning red. It is a more general term that can be used to describe anything with a reddish hue, including hair. 3. “Zanahorias” – Although less common, this term translates to “carrots” in English. It is a playful way to refer to red heads, comparing their hair color to that of a carrot.
